[MYSQL] Replication en Duplicate entry error

Pagina: 1
Acties:

  • xantos
  • Registratie: Juni 1999
  • Niet online
Op mijn master en slave db draai ik beide versie: Ver 12.22 Distrib 4.0.17, for pc-linux-gnu (i686) van MySQL.

Ik zet de replicate aan volgens de handleiding op mysql.com en start vervolgens de slave server. De synchronisatie lijkt goed te werken totdat deze morgen de internet verbinding van de slave-db uitvalt (logisch).

Op het moment dat de internetverbinding weer herstelt is, begint de slave-db weer met repliceren maar stopt plotseling met de melding: Slave: Error 'Duplicate entry '<' for key 2' on query 'UPDATE blabla FROM blabla'' etc...

Weet iemand waarom dit gebeurd? De slave server moet toch gewoon alle queries kunnen uitvoeren net zoals op de master server? Zonder een 'Duplicate key' error te krijgen.

Ik las ergens dat het kan voorkomen als een update query van een bepaald record meerdere keren in de log voorkomt... zie http://www.faqchest.com/p.../mysql02022209_15839.html

Iemand een idee???

[ Voor 9% gewijzigd door xantos op 06-02-2004 10:29 ]


  • Tomaat
  • Registratie: November 2001
  • Laatst online: 19-02 14:23
En als je dat record nu eens verwijderd uit de DB op de slave machine, en de replicatie dan weer start?

  • xantos
  • Registratie: Juni 1999
  • Niet online
Ik wil eigenlijk weten waarom dit probleem zich voordoet.

Als ik een record verwijder op de slave machine is mijn replicatie niet exact hetzelfde geweest. :?

  • Tomaat
  • Registratie: November 2001
  • Laatst online: 19-02 14:23
Ik neem aan dat de slave machine een exacte kopie maakt van de DB op de master machine? Dus er worden alleen wijzigingen gemaakt op de master die vervolgens naar de slave worden gerepliceerd..of ook de andere kant op? Zo ja, dan word het lastig ja..

  • xantos
  • Registratie: Juni 1999
  • Niet online
Nee alleen eenrichting uiteraard. Kan het een bug zijn in versie 4.0.17??

Als ik opnieuw een binaire kopie maak van de master naar de slave en de replicatie weer start, lijkt het weer goed te gaan. Na 45 minuten verscheen er weer een 'Duplicate key' error melding. :'(

  • xantos
  • Registratie: Juni 1999
  • Niet online
Zijn er nog meer mensen die de replicatie functie gebruiken met versie 4.0.17??
Pagina: 1